Factors to Consider When Selecting a Tire Repair Shop
When searching for a tire repair shop, there are several factors to consider to ensure you find a reputable and reliable provider. Here are some key factors to consider:
Experience and Qualifications
Look for a shop with experienced technicians who have undergone training and have the necessary certifications. Check if the shop is affiliated with reputable organizations, such as the National Tire Dealers & Retreaders Association (NTDRA) or the Automotive Service Association (ASA).
Equipment and Facilities
A modern and well-equipped shop is essential for providing high-quality services. Check if the shop has the latest equipment and machinery to diagnose and repair tires efficiently. Ensure the shop has a clean and organized workspace, as this reflects the level of professionalism and attention to detail.
Reviews and Reputation
Check online reviews from reputable sources, such as Yelp, Google, or Facebook, to gauge the shop’s reputation. Pay attention to the overall rating and read the reviews to identify any common issues or concerns. You can also ask friends, family, or coworkers for recommendations. Frequently Asked Questions
Q: What are the most common tire repair services?
A: The most common tire repair services include tire puncture repair, tire balancing, tire rotation, and tire replacement. Some shops may also offer additional services, such as wheel alignment and brake repair.
Q: How often should I get my tires repaired?
A: It’s recommended to get your tires repaired as soon as possible if you notice any signs of damage or wear. Regular tire maintenance can help extend the life of your tires and prevent costly repairs.
Q: Can I repair a tire myself?
A: While it’s possible to repair a tire yourself, it’s recommended to leave it to a professional. Tire repair requires specialized equipment and expertise to ensure a safe and effective repair. Additionally, improper repairs can lead to further damage or even accidents. (See Also: What Does Load Range E On A Tire Mean? – Explained)
Q: How much does tire repair cost?
A: The cost of tire repair varies depending on the type of service required, the location, and the shop. On average, tire repair costs range from $10 to $50 per tire, although more extensive repairs can cost significantly more.
